A virtual DPO, also known as an outsourced or external DPO, is an independent expert who provides data protection services to organizations on a part-time basis They are responsible for advising, monitoring, and ensuring compliance with data protection laws and regulations The primary role of a virtual DPO is to act as a bridge between the organization and regulatory authorities, ensuring that data protection requirements are met and risks are mitigated.
One of the main benefits of hiring a virtual DPO is cost-effectiveness Instead of hiring a full-time DPO, which can be expensive for smaller organizations, a virtual DPO offers a more flexible and affordable solution This allows organizations to access the expertise and guidance of a DPO without the need for a permanent hire.
Another advantage of a virtual DPO is the breadth of expertise they bring to the table Virtual DPOs are often experienced professionals with a deep understanding of data protection laws and regulations They can provide valuable insights and guidance to organizations on complex data protection issues, helping them navigate the ever-changing landscape of data privacy.

Virtual DPOs also offer flexibility in terms of availability and scalability Organizations can engage a virtual DPO on a part-time or as-needed basis, depending on their specific requirements This allows organizations to tailor the level of support they receive from the virtual DPO to meet their unique data protection needs Furthermore, as the organization grows or its data protection requirements change, the virtual DPO can scale their services accordingly.
When it comes to data protection, compliance is key Organizations that fail to comply with data protection laws and regulations can face severe penalties, including fines and damage to their reputation A virtual DPO can help organizations stay on top of their data protection responsibilities and ensure compliance with relevant laws, such as the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R) and the California Consumer Privacy Act (CCPA).
